#7d9001 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d9001 is composed of 49% red, 56.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.3%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 68 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 28.4%. #7d9001 color hex could be obtained by blending #faff02 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#7d9001

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070800 is the darkest color, while #fdfff3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d9001

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4d44 is the less saturated color, while #7d9001 is the most saturated one.
